Snuggle and Play Crochet: 40 Amigurumi Patterns for Security Blankets and Matching Toys | Carolina Guzman Benitez
6 posts | 4 read | 1 reading | 1 to read
Snuggle up with a crochet comforter or play with a colourful character--this unique collection of 40 amigurumi patterns are simple to stitch and super cute! Featuring crochet toy patterns including boy and girl dolls, dogs and cats, bears and bunnies and many more, this amazing collection will give you over 40 different crochet toys to create.

These patterns are perfect for crocheters who are ready to move on from beginning projects. Easy, clear instructions are given in charts AND written-out format. I've always wanted to learn to read the charts, and seeing the side-by-side formats was SO helpful. I love that the patterns for the blankets are separate from the stuffed animals. Easy to mix, match, personalize (which is why my fox lovey pictured above is gray, per my 8yo's request!)

This book has the cutest patterns! Already made four of the twenty animals included myself and I love that each animal has both a toy and lovey option... Quite easy to follow even for crochet newbies like myself. Minor complaint: I don't like the teddy head proportions; the head seems huge in comparison to the body or other animals. Still love this book though and they make the perfect gift for newborns or small kids! ❤

4,5/5 stars.
